Residents Desperate for Mass Harvest of Palm Oil, Central Kalimantan Police Apply Article on Theft

The company's mass harvest of palm fruit continues. Seven people were arrested and jailed for allegedly stealing.

PALANGKARAYA, KOMPAS - Residents of Mentaya Hulu District, East Kotawaringin Regency, Central Kalimantan, harvested a mass of palm fruit in a plantation area belonging to a company. The police considered this action as theft. However, a local palm farmer advocacy group called it a protest against the inadequate welfare of plasma farmers.

On April 6, 2024, police arrested seven people in a case of palm fruit theft in a palm plantation owned by a company in Mentaya Hulu District, East Kotawaringin Regency. The police confiscated several pieces of evidence, including two pickup trucks used for transporting palm fruit and harvesting equipment such as egrek, tojok, and angkong. The police also seized several stolen palm fruit bunches.
